The Science Behind Teeth Whitening
Professional teeth whitening uses hydrogen peroxide or carbamide peroxide to break down stain molecules inside the enamel through oxidation. This chemical process lightens the color of your teeth from the inside out, not just superficially.
The procedure typically involves:
- A complete oral check-up and scaling & polishing to remove external stains and plaque
- Application of a protective barrier for gums
- Precise application of whitening gel by a trained dentist
DIY products either contain unregulated levels of peroxide or lack effectiveness, leading to frustration or irreversible harm.

Common Misconceptions About Whitening
- “Whitening is permanent” — False.
Teeth whitening typically last 6 months to 1.5 years depending on lifestyle habits, diet, and maintenance.
- “Scaling and whitening are the same” — Absolutely not.
Scaling and polishing (oral prophylaxis) removes surface stains, plaque, and tartar. Whitening changes the internal tooth shade using clinical-grade bleaching agents.
- “Whitening ruins enamel” — Incorrect.
Professionally administered whitening uses pH-balanced, enamel-safe formulations under strict supervision.
Importance of Oral Prophylaxis Before Whitening
Before any whitening session, your teeth must be clean and plaque-free. That’s why oral prophylaxis is a mandatory pre-requisite. Without this:
- Whitening results will be patchy and ineffective
- Gums may become inflamed during treatment
- Surface stains will resist bleach penetration, reducing effectiveness
Who Should Avoid Whitening?
- Pregnant or lactating women
- Children under 16
- Patients with untreated caries, gum infections, or dental hypersensitivity
- Those with porcelain crowns, veneers, or fillings in visible zones (as whitening won’t affect them)
